Transaction 055376db8752853efb76c328a3b25fb5340f3238c4ac149fe4e2e88ec348ac91
1 Input
2 Outputs
- 055376db8752853efb76c328a3b25fb5340f3238c4ac149fe4e2e88ec348ac91:0
- 055376db8752853efb76c328a3b25fb5340f3238c4ac149fe4e2e88ec348ac91:1
value 99900000
address 1KAb6LcZC2oWEE7KKUbbJrRaizVNbvDrj2
value 443304075
address 12Ksg7M4AzMLagc4AkU7SQRKAzqAbNgcKa